Clients turn to Request for a variety of services, predominately
centered two core specialities: We work with clients showing them how to identify, qualify
and purchase properties at each of five steps in the foreclosure process. Risks
and rewards are introduced and discussed at each step with emphasis on the two
commonly accepted purchasing techniques. Laws affecting foreclosure purchasing
are examined. More than just academic instruction, clients are shown how to
examine properties at governmental research facilities and how to prepare for
and attend trustees sales for those properties. We are sometimes hired as an experienced professional to identify
and qualify foreclosure properties to be purchased with the clients cash.
No training is involved in this option. I offer the experience while they offer
the cash necessary to purchase in their own names. An equity sharing agreement
is set up so both parties benefit from this close and rewarding association. At the request of clients, we are also am available
to help the foreclosure property buyer sell the rehabilitated property. Thirty
years of experience as a successful, licensed California Real Estate Broker
can be extremely helpful when the purchased property is converted into profit
upon sale. This site is intended as a general guide. It covers matters of real estate.
